Table 27-1 Menu 27.2 SA Monitor

FIELD DESCRIPTION EXAMPLE

#

This is the security association index number.

1

Name

This field displays the identification name for this VPN policy. This name is
unique for each connection where the secure gateway IP address is a
public static IP address.

When the secure gateway IP address is 0.0.0.0 (as discussed in the last
chapter), there may be different connections using this same VPN rule. In
this case, the name is followed by the remote IP address as configured in
Menu 27.1.1. – IPSec Setup. Individual connections using the same VPN
rule may be terminated without affecting other connections using the same
rule.

IPSec
Algorithm

This field displays the security protocols used for an SA. ESP provides
confidentiality and integrity of data by encrypting the data and
encapsulating it into IP packets. Encryption methods include 56-bit DES
and 168-bit 3DES. NULL denotes a tunnel without encryption.

An incoming SA may have an AH in addition to ESP. The Authentication
Header provides strong integrity and authentication by adding
authentication information to IP packets. This authentication information is
calculated using header and payload data in the IP packet. This provides
an additional level of security. AH choices are MD5 (default - 128 bits)
and SHA -1(160 bits).

Both AH and ESP increase Prestige processing requirements and
communications latency (delay).

Select
Command

Press [SPACE BAR] to choose from Refresh, Disconnect or None and
then press [ENTER]. You must select a connection in the next field when
you choose the Disconnect command. Refresh displays current active
VPN connections. None allows you to jump to the “Press ENTER to
Confirm…” prompt.

Refresh

Select
Connection

Type the VPN connection index number that you want to disconnect and
then press [ENTER].

1

When you have completed this menu, press [ENTER] at the prompt “Press ENTER to Confirm…” to save your
configuration, or press [ESC] at any time to cancel.
